[QUOTE]Originally posted by Mr. Toy: [QB] [QUOTE]Originally posted by Mike Smith: [qb] McCain has had 25+ years to cut off all Amtrak funding in the US Senate, and you believed he would do it as President, but not as a Senator? [/qb][/QUOTE]Not that he didn't try. McCain consistently voted against funding Amtrak, and will probably continue to do so. But as one vote, he was swimming against the current so his influence was minor. As president, he would have power of the veto, which he threatened to use against any Amtrak bill. Ii might add that McCain was the one who introduced the Bush Amtrak "reform" plan in the Senate, but the bill died a mercifully quick death when nobody would join him in supporting it. It is an excellent example of how out of touch McCain has been in regards to Amtrak. [/QB][/QUOTE]
